Abstrait
  • This thesis tested a liturgy-based, premarital preparation program with five engaged couples and five clergy. This program is designed to help a couple understand the liturgical, theological and psychological dynamics of a wedding liturgy and Christian marriage. It is designed for clergy in the Presbyterian Church (USA) as a companion and study guide to 'Christian Marriage, Rite I-A Service for General Use,' Christian marriage: the worship of God. Supplemental liturgical resource 3. This marriage rite is the foundation for the program which enables couples to plan worship, understand Scripture readings and explore their vows as promises of a marriage covenant.
